2004 Pos.Super-Salmon female from Rich Ihle

Still a relatively small girl on fuzzies. I think she will be moving up to pups in about a month. She is my second smallest boa, the smallest being Mr.Clean who just took his first fuzzy. They are both fixing to be yearlings too!

She was really squirmish today. I couldnt get her to hold still at all for pics on the deck. I manage to snap just one full body shot on the deck. It was at around 1:00, so the sun wasnt at enough of a slant for angled deck shots anyway.

I got a belly shot off... her belly is very orange. She is my orangest boa, my 03 male Nefarion coming in a close second (should make for a nice salmon x salmon breeding down the road).






In this shot I attempted to show the color that is coming in on the top of her body (often it will just stay on their sides). She shed yesterday and I noticed significantly more:
